Firstly, What Exactly is the Achilles Tendon?
Your Achilles tendon connects the muscles at the back of your calf—named the gastrocnemius and soleus muscles—to your heel bone. It is a thick, strong tendon that plays a pivotal role in enabling you to walk, run, jump or even climb stairs comfortably. Given its constant daily use, it’s no surprise that many individuals, especially athletes or those regularly participating in sports, experience strain, inflammation or ruptures in this crucial tendon.
How Does an Achilles Tendon Rupture Occur?
A rupture of the Achilles tendon typically happens through abrupt forceful action or sudden acceleration. Sports activities such as sprinting, basketball, tennis or football often see individuals sustaining a sudden Achilles injury. Middle-aged individuals who perform irregular physical activity (“weekend-warriors”) can be particularly vulnerable too.
When rupture occurs, you’ll often hear a loud snapping or popping sound, immediately followed by sharp, severe pain at the back of the ankle or calf. Some individuals even describe feeling as though they were struck in the back of their leg by an object.
The Role of Gap Size in Achilles Tendon Injuries
When your Achilles tendon ruptures, the muscle tendon unit retracts, creating a physical gap between the severed ends. Gap size refers precisely to this distance. Although it might sound technical, understanding gap size is essential for patients and medical professionals alike because it significantly influences treatment decisions and ultimately impacts recovery outcomes.
Why the Gap Size Matters in Healing and Recovery
Medical studies and clinical experiences clearly demonstrate that a smaller gap size helps to ensure better healing and recovery outcomes. Larger gaps, on the contrary, can pose challenges for effective healing and typically require more extensive medical interventions.
A wide gap between tendon ends prevents natural healing processes from easily taking place. The body relies partly on the two torn ends of the tendon being close enough for scar tissue to bridge the healing gap and ultimately restore functional strength and alignment. An excessively large gap can interfere with effective scarring, tissue regeneration and leads to functional deficits further down the line—meaning a prolonged recovery or even incomplete healing.
Determining the Gap Size: Imaging and Diagnosis
In clinical practice, the gap size of your Achilles rupture is assessed using imaging techniques, primarily ultrasound or MRI scans. Ultrasound is most commonly used initially as it’s readily available, more cost-effective and provides immediate visualisation of the gap between the tendon ends. MRI, while less routinely used, delivers detailed high-quality images and can further clarify difficult or complex tendon ruptures.
When clinicians understand precisely how large the gap is, they can recommend either surgical interventions to physically approximate or reconnect the tendon or suggest conservative management options, such as specialised immobilisation techniques that position the foot in such a way that shrinks the gap over time.
Treatment Based on Gap Size Measurements
Medical professionals typically categorise tendon gap sizes into smaller ruptures (usually less than 1cm gap), moderate (between 1cm-3cm), or severe (larger than 3cm). These measurements guide the treatment route chosen by your healthcare provider, whether conservative or surgical.
Smaller gaps (under 1cm) often benefit from immobilisation treatments like casting or wearing a specialised walking boot in the foot-down position, bringing the tendon ends together and allowing them to heal effectively without surgery.
Moderate gaps between 1cm and 3cm may also respond positively to conservative treatments, but often careful monitoring, regular imaging, and methodical physiotherapy are essential. Surgeons might suggest surgical intervention depending on individual activity levels, lifestyle requirements, age and overall health.
For severe ruptures, where gaps extend beyond 3cm, surgical intervention is frequently recommended to physically repair the tendon. Surgical repair has been shown to reduce re-rupture rates and improve the likelihood of regaining full strength and consistent functionality. After surgery, you might use a walking boot or crutches to assist mobility and protect the tendon as it heals.

What Can You Expect During Recovery?
Whether you manage your Achilles tendon rupture conservatively or surgically, your recovery phase will involve careful immobilisation, gradual progression of weight-bearing and above all, guided physiotherapy. Active physiotherapy is crucial for regaining balance, strength, range of motion and rebuilding confidence in your mobility.
Initially, tendon protection with crutches, walking boots or braces is highly advisable, ensuring minimal strain on your healing tendon. This allows controlled loading once healing becomes sufficiently advanced. Physiotherapy rehabilitation typically begins gently to reinstate tendon strength progressively with a phased exercise program tailored individually.
Recovery timelines vary considerably according to factors such as gap size, treatment chosen, patient age, health status and adherence to rehabilitative guidance. Typically, Achilles tendon rupture recovery can take anywhere from four to twelve months until full strength, balance and confidence are achieved.
